Crete is special to me because its peaceful and you can enjoy the lazy afternoons where the locals understand you and wont disturb you.
Favourite restaurants in Crete: El Greco, Stalis, check out the pizza's they make for the resturant accross the road, mmmm!
Favourite accommodation in Crete: the Ariadne Beach, luxurious gardens, peaceful and relaxed but just located to be just a few yards from all the fun.
Favourite beach in Crete: at the hotel, Ariadne Beach
You have to see in Crete: Spinalonga island, Chania, Rethymnon, Agios Nikolaos.
Night Life in Crete: Stalis main road, bars, pubs. Check out the "Malia" bar: its run by Joy an irish girl, its not the best and you might walk past it as the sign is rather small, she'll give you a real frendly welcome and the music is just right, also, further down on the left check out the beautiful South Bar, good ale, good music no kareoke.
Off the beaten path in Crete: Mochos village, very old and authentic and a great welcome, as ever in Crete.
When in Crete be careful about the dreaded quads, they are everywhere.
Transportation: bus or coach trip with a guide.
Cultural Tips: Cave of Zeus, the island of Dia not much there to be honest but the boat trip is fantastic.
